Documenta is a prestigious art exhibition held in Kassel, Germany, every five years. The appointment of a new committee indicates a significant change in the organization’s structure and approach.

Documenta has a long history of showcasing cutting-edge contemporary art and providing a platform for artists from around the world to exhibit their work.
